Form 4: Eversource CEO Nolan Gifts Shares, Updates Filing Authority

Sentiment:

Insider Transaction Report


Eversource Energy's Chairman, President, and CEO, Joseph R. Nolan Jr., reported gifting 2,600 common shares and updated his power of attorney for SEC filings.

Summary

  • Joseph R. Nolan Jr., Chairman, President, and CEO of Eversource Energy (ES), reported changes in his beneficial ownership of common shares.
  • On November 6, 2025, Nolan gifted 1,560 common shares of Eversource Energy.
  • On November 7, 2025, Nolan gifted an additional 1,040 common shares of Eversource Energy.
  • Both transactions were reported as gifts, with a price of $0 per share.
  • Following these transactions, Nolan directly beneficially owned 141,493 common shares, which includes restricted share units and dividend equivalents.
  • Nolan also indirectly holds 25,029 shares in the Eversource 401k Plan and 72,898 phantom shares in a non-qualified deferred compensation plan, which represent the right to receive common shares upon a distribution event.

Industry Context

Insider transaction reports like Form 4 are routine disclosures for publicly traded companies, providing transparency into the stock ownership and trading activities of their executives and directors. Gifting shares is a common personal financial planning strategy for executives.
